博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
Sencha 基础Demo测试,三种showView的方法
阅读量:7053 次
发布时间:2019-06-28

本文共 1734 字,大约阅读时间需要 5 分钟。

直接贴代码吧

Ext.define("build.controller.MainController",{    extend:"Ext.app.Controller",    config:{        refs:{            mainDataview:"main dataview",            createAdd:"createAdd"        },        control:{            "mainDataview":{                itemtap:function(data,index,item,record,event){                    //测试三种展示View的方法................                    console.log(record)                    switch (record.data.id){                        case "1":                            console.log(1111)                            /*第一种方式*/                            var c1=Ext.create("build.view.CreateAdd");                            Ext.Viewport.add(c1);                            Ext.Viewport.setActiveItem(c1);                            break;                        case "2":                            console.log(2222)                            /*第二种方式,这种方式和case3这种show的方式其实是一样de,但是这个先将对象拿出,是为了方便给这个对象设置属性,比如说*/                            var c2=this.getCreateAdd();                            if(c2==null){                                c2=Ext.create("build.view.CreateAdd")                            }                            Ext.Viewport.animateActiveItem(c2,{type:"slide",direction:'left'})                 //c2.setXXXXX()                            break;                        case "3":                            console.log(3333)                            /*第三种方式*/                            Ext.Viewport.animateActiveItem("createAdd",{type:"slide",direction:'right'})                            break;                    }                    Ext.getCmp("detailView").setTitle(record.data.name)                }            }        }    }})

 

转载于:https://www.cnblogs.com/Brose/p/sencha_view.html

你可能感兴趣的文章
魔法森林[NOI2014]
查看>>
bzoj4002[JLOI2015]有意义的字符串
查看>>
python爬虫-抓取acg12动漫壁纸排行设置为桌面壁纸
查看>>
用QQ传dll文件,你可能会遇到灵异事件
查看>>
hbase meta表的结构
查看>>
2017-2-10
查看>>
Git
查看>>
centos7.4 安装后的基本设置
查看>>
SQLCipher 配置
查看>>
函数的定义、作用域、函数递归
查看>>
纯手工 css+html 简易三级导航栏(横向)
查看>>
个人码风
查看>>
基于昨天调代码的收获
查看>>
iOS多线程编程之Grand Central Dispatch(GCD)介绍和使用
查看>>
QT编写TCP的问题
查看>>
poj1456 结构体排序+贪心
查看>>
javascript 乘法口诀表
查看>>
views 视图函数
查看>>
MySql详解(一)
查看>>
解题思路:蓄水池问题
查看>>